#1 Hassan Whiteside's monster stat line against the Spurs back in November

Hassan's eight of his nine blocks came in the first half.

The Spurs were at the receiving ends of the one of the most dominant big man runs ever on both ends of the floor. Whiteside dropped 29 points, pulled down 20 boards and swatted the ball away 9 times, making him the first player since Shawn Bradley in 1994 to put up a 25-point, 20-rebound, 9-block game.

This made him only the eighth player in NBA history to have such a game as Miami beat San Antonio 95-88.

He shot an impressive 10-of-18(56%) from the field and went to the free-throw line 11 times (and converted on 9 of those) during his 32 minutes on the court. He put together a magnificent first half, which involved 18 points, 14 boards and 8 blocks en route to a memorable night altogether.
